Output 87856696e6530dfd06878331052f7a75182415e135b9e4bc2d0e87d051f602d1:1

value
684000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65462b510996b4c6ae5e5ed52b51c39813382e5 OP_EQUAL
address
3MEHcopTLc7vcUx2Q3ZaD5mtcBtNHANDrb
transaction
87856696e6530dfd06878331052f7a75182415e135b9e4bc2d0e87d051f602d1
spent
true